- Exploring The Masai MaraWritten By Uyaphi.comThe vast Masai Mara National Reserve spans approximately 1,510 square kilometres. Named for the Maasai tribe, the south-western Kenya location has the world famous Serengeti Park forming the southern border. The terrain consists of clumps of trees, shrubbery and open savannahs...................

Sarova Salt Lick Game Lodge
Sarova Salt Lick Game Lodge offers an unparalleled safari experience by means of game drives in the stunning Tsavo West National Park.
The entire lodge is raised on high stilts above watering holes and feeding pastures, offering a spectacular view of the wildlife from above and all around.

Turtle Bay Beach Club
Turtle Bay Beach Club is situated on 200 metres of beach on the edge of the Watamu National Marine Park, one of the best in Kenya, the hotel buildings are set in 10 acres of tropically landscaped gardens with 145 rooms.
A beach resort that offers more activities than one could possibly imagine.

Elephant Pepper Camp
Elephant Pepper Bush Camp, this 8-tented bush camp, is tucked away in a prime wildlife area, surrounded by the Masai Mara and her ubiquitous wildlife; it's a seasonal camp, which is taken down for a month or so in the rainy seasons.
Game drives are the highlight of one's stay here at Elephant Pepper, with fantastic wildlife and excellent guides.
